Looking for some real experience with 6.5 PRC SI, have a few components I might put to use in 2026, cartridge looks like a great one, a plus is Lapua brass is available. My plan would be a 20 inch barrel for hunting, to be shot suppressed. How much more are you gaining in FPS, with the other added benefits of improved cartridges? Likely run 140s, maybe 156s. Thanks
 
Have one. 20" 1:8 Suppressed. Getting 2980 with a full case of rl23. No pressure signs. Could go faster with a faster powder but shoots great. Mild recoil. And I like the case full, so why change it?

Running low on rl23, so when I'm out I may try 4831sc, h1000, or a Vv powder. Maybe 165.

It took 4 deer and an elk this year. All 1 shot kills no tracking required. To say I'm happy would be an understatement

Also worth noting, it shot factory prc brass and 140 bergers 1/2 moa. So fireforming doesn't need to be "a waste" you can hunt with fireforming loads no problem.

Lance's post were a big help for load dev and he was very helpful and reassuring in going down this path. Glad I did.

Also have a 20 inch. Shoot these groups this morning ignore the 2 in the middle. They were 156 Berger's. Top group is h1000 and 153 Berger's at 3015 and bottom group was 565 at 2950. I've tested n560, 565,570, and h1000. I ran 135 atips last year at 3150. This year went to 156's and they've killed well.

I also have one, 20" barrel running 60.5g N565 with a 156 Berger at 2960fps and no pressure signs
